Training Support Team Specialist

Department: PTS - Dawson Technical
Location: Fort Leonard Wood, MO

Job Summary : :Performs duties necessary to facilitate training in the toxic training area, which includes; the setup of the toxic areas, serving as the movement controller for student groups, handlers of the nerve agent, and decontamination of the toxic after daily operations. Serves as the Emergency Response Team onsite during toxic agent training operations. Provide grounds keeping and general maintenance for an approximate 10 acre training facility.

Work hours: 07:00am – 03:45pm, Mon-Fri

Roles and Responsibilities

  • Set up and tear down “Hot Area” training venues.
  • Perform functions as an Agent Handler.
  • Support all activities associated with toxic operations in the laboratory.
  • Support training on outdoor rehearsal pads.
  • Set-up and recover interior toxic area and outdoor training venues.
  • Set-up emergency response equipment – respond to emergencies.
  • Conduct personnel decontamination and DOFF.
  • Decontaminate and clean the hot area recovery.
  • Collect, sort, and containerize trash.
  • Restock and reset the hot area.
  • Must meet Chemical Personnel Reliability Program requirements.
  • Must be clean shaven and physically able to wear military protective masks, chemical protective overgarments, and work in lethal toxic hazard areas up to 6 continuous hours.
  • Comply with established safety procedures.
  • Complete all associated administrative tasks.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Qualifications:

  • High School Graduate or equivalent.
  • Former emergency management HAZMAT technician or Army Technical Escort experience preferred.
  • Experience handling hazardous materials (agents) preferred.
  • Must maintain fitness-for-duty standards (CAT 1 Physical).
  • Must be able to wear and work in various levels of personal protective clothing.
  • Must comply with the Drug Free Workplace Program.
  • Must be able to meet Government Medical Surveillance Program requirements.
  • Must be able to meet and have a favorable adjudicated T3 Investigation
  • Experienced in Hazardous Materials, Hazardous Waste Management, and Environmental Science
  • Must meet Fort Leonard Wood installation access requirements.
  • Must be able to read and write English.
